Receiptwright is the service that generates and mails donation receipts for the Lanternmoor Foundation. During the ceremony, two custodians generate the signing key used to authenticate outgoing receipt batches; the key is split and stored in separate safes at the Dovehill office. New team members should observe but not handle key material during their first ceremony. Before sealing the safes, the lead custodian verifies the escrow bundle, which is protected by the recovery passphrase written below.

vault phrase of tajop-haduf = holath-brivan-wenax

**Q: How do blue-green deploys affect my plugin when the Ledgerfin billing worker flips environments?**

During a cutover, both the blue and green workers may briefly process jobs. Plugins must tolerate duplicate invocations and avoid caching worker-instance state across requests. Version pinning is honored per environment, so test against the staging color announced in the release notes. If your plugin behaves differently between colors, report it to the platform team at the address below.

escalation mailbox, bafog-fafog: ulador@paliqlabs.internal

Changed defaults in Splitfork, our assignment service. Bucketing now uses sticky hashing per account instead of per session, and the holdout slice grew from 2% to 5%. Callers relying on session-level reassignment must opt in explicitly. Review the diff against the new baseline; the updated default configuration is listed below.

config for tagep-kajof:
[casir]
port = 6379
region = south-1
host = casir.paliqdyn.example
team = tamax
timeout_ms = 250
retries = 2

**Parity runbook — Kestrelkit SDKs**

JS and Kotlin SDKs must ship the same feature flags each release. Run the parity diff script against both manifests; any mismatch blocks the tag. The diff tool pulls gated flag definitions from the registry, so set `PARITY_REGISTRY_ENV=prod` and put the registry read secret on the next line.

vault entry, yahif-yajep: COURIER_KEY29=b802bdf8034096b65a51c6ba5abe2

## Env Vars — Pulsegrid Sidecar

Welcome aboard! The Pulsegrid sidecar scrapes metrics from the app pod and ships them to the aggregator every 15 seconds. Most knobs have sane defaults — flush interval, batch size, all that. The only thing you must set yourself is the ingest credential, so add this line to your env file:

sealed setting: ARCHIVE_KEY3=8d0